This is not about an actual dialogue, but one that you write in your journal. I use two different color pens – one for myself and one for the person I am having the conversation with.
This may seem a bit odd at first, but it is a very powerful tool. You can dialogue with someone living or not, someone real or imaginary.
For instance, the other day, I had concerns over something, so I had a dialogue in my journal with one of my favorite people – my Brat!! I once told a friend that I didn’t have an inner child, I had an inner brat! She said, “No, you have an outer brat!!!”
My brat is one of the voices in my head. You know, you have them too, one is usually the critic. But in this case, my brat is the voice of a teenage girl. Not just any teenage girl, but one with attitude.
It’s great to get a different perspective. For instance, I write something like – What if I don’t get this done on time?” And she says, “Puhleeze!! You know you always do whatever it takes to get something finished!” “You’re right, I’m usually pretty good at that.” And she says, “DUH!” See what I mean about the attitude.
My Jem for you today is to have a dialogue with someone in your journal. It’s a great way to utilize the voices in your head to figure things out. Have fun with this.
